├── LICENSE ├── README.md ├── mariadb ├── Dockerfile ├── README.md ├── cert-enroller.sh ├── cert-post-enroll-hook.sh ├── cert-post-renew-hook.sh ├── cert-renewer.sh └── entrypoint-shim.sh ├── mongodb ├── Dockerfile ├── README.md ├── cert-enroller.sh ├── cert-post-enroll-hook.sh ├── cert-post-renew-hook.sh ├── cert-renewer.sh └── entrypoint-shim.sh ├── mysql ├── Dockerfile ├── README.md ├── cert-enroller.sh ├── cert-post-enroll-hook.sh ├── cert-post-renew-hook.sh ├── cert-renewer.sh └── entrypoint-shim.sh ├── nginx-unit ├── Dockerfile ├── README.md ├── cert-enroller.sh ├── cert-post-enroll-hook.sh ├── cert-post-renew-hook.sh ├── cert-renewer.sh ├── config.json ├── entrypoint-shim.sh ├── requirements.txt └── webapp │ └── wsgi.py ├── postgresql ├── Dockerfile ├── README.md ├── cert-enroller.sh ├── cert-post-enroll-hook.sh ├── cert-post-renew-hook.sh ├── cert-renewer.sh └── entrypoint-shim.sh ├── rabbitmq ├── Dockerfile ├── README.md ├── cert-enroller.sh ├── cert-post-enroll-hook.sh ├── cert-post-renew-hook.sh ├── cert-renewer.sh ├── entrypoint-shim.sh └── rabbitmq-tls.conf ├── redis-ionotify-certwatch ├── Dockerfile ├── README.md ├── certwatch.sh └── docker-entrypoint.sh ├── redis ├── Dockerfile ├── README.md ├── cert-enroller.sh ├── cert-post-enroll-hook.sh ├── cert-post-renew-hook.sh ├── cert-renewer.sh └── entrypoint-shim.sh └── timescaledb ├── Dockerfile ├── README.md ├── cert-enroller.sh ├── cert-post-enroll-hook.sh ├── cert-post-renew-hook.sh ├── cert-renewer.sh └── entrypoint-shim.sh /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/README.md -------------------------------------------------------------------------------- /mariadb/Dockerfile: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/mariadb/Dockerfile -------------------------------------------------------------------------------- /mariadb/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/mariadb/README.md -------------------------------------------------------------------------------- /mariadb/cert-enroller.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/mariadb/cert-enroller.sh -------------------------------------------------------------------------------- /mariadb/cert-post-enroll-hook.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/mariadb/cert-post-enroll-hook.sh -------------------------------------------------------------------------------- /mariadb/cert-post-renew-hook.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/mariadb/cert-post-renew-hook.sh -------------------------------------------------------------------------------- /mariadb/cert-renewer.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/mariadb/cert-renewer.sh -------------------------------------------------------------------------------- /mariadb/entrypoint-shim.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/mariadb/entrypoint-shim.sh -------------------------------------------------------------------------------- /mongodb/Dockerfile: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/mongodb/Dockerfile -------------------------------------------------------------------------------- /mongodb/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/mongodb/README.md -------------------------------------------------------------------------------- /mongodb/cert-enroller.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/mongodb/cert-enroller.sh -------------------------------------------------------------------------------- /mongodb/cert-post-enroll-hook.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/mongodb/cert-post-enroll-hook.sh -------------------------------------------------------------------------------- /mongodb/cert-post-renew-hook.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/mongodb/cert-post-renew-hook.sh -------------------------------------------------------------------------------- /mongodb/cert-renewer.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/mongodb/cert-renewer.sh -------------------------------------------------------------------------------- /mongodb/entrypoint-shim.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/mongodb/entrypoint-shim.sh -------------------------------------------------------------------------------- /mysql/Dockerfile: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/mysql/Dockerfile -------------------------------------------------------------------------------- /mysql/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/mysql/README.md -------------------------------------------------------------------------------- /mysql/cert-enroller.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/mysql/cert-enroller.sh -------------------------------------------------------------------------------- /mysql/cert-post-enroll-hook.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/mysql/cert-post-enroll-hook.sh -------------------------------------------------------------------------------- /mysql/cert-post-renew-hook.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/mysql/cert-post-renew-hook.sh -------------------------------------------------------------------------------- /mysql/cert-renewer.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/mysql/cert-renewer.sh -------------------------------------------------------------------------------- /mysql/entrypoint-shim.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/mysql/entrypoint-shim.sh -------------------------------------------------------------------------------- /nginx-unit/Dockerfile: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/nginx-unit/Dockerfile -------------------------------------------------------------------------------- /nginx-unit/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/nginx-unit/README.md -------------------------------------------------------------------------------- /nginx-unit/cert-enroller.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/nginx-unit/cert-enroller.sh -------------------------------------------------------------------------------- /nginx-unit/cert-post-enroll-hook.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/nginx-unit/cert-post-enroll-hook.sh -------------------------------------------------------------------------------- /nginx-unit/cert-post-renew-hook.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/nginx-unit/cert-post-renew-hook.sh -------------------------------------------------------------------------------- /nginx-unit/cert-renewer.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/nginx-unit/cert-renewer.sh -------------------------------------------------------------------------------- /nginx-unit/config.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/nginx-unit/config.json -------------------------------------------------------------------------------- /nginx-unit/entrypoint-shim.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/nginx-unit/entrypoint-shim.sh -------------------------------------------------------------------------------- /nginx-unit/requirements.txt: -------------------------------------------------------------------------------- 1 | flask 2 | -------------------------------------------------------------------------------- /nginx-unit/webapp/wsgi.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/nginx-unit/webapp/wsgi.py -------------------------------------------------------------------------------- /postgresql/Dockerfile: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/postgresql/Dockerfile -------------------------------------------------------------------------------- /postgresql/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/postgresql/README.md -------------------------------------------------------------------------------- /postgresql/cert-enroller.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/postgresql/cert-enroller.sh -------------------------------------------------------------------------------- /postgresql/cert-post-enroll-hook.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/postgresql/cert-post-enroll-hook.sh -------------------------------------------------------------------------------- /postgresql/cert-post-renew-hook.sh: -------------------------------------------------------------------------------- 1 | #!/bin/bash 2 | 3 | gosu postgres pg_ctl reload 4 | -------------------------------------------------------------------------------- /postgresql/cert-renewer.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/postgresql/cert-renewer.sh -------------------------------------------------------------------------------- /postgresql/entrypoint-shim.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/postgresql/entrypoint-shim.sh -------------------------------------------------------------------------------- /rabbitmq/Dockerfile: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/rabbitmq/Dockerfile -------------------------------------------------------------------------------- /rabbitmq/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/rabbitmq/README.md -------------------------------------------------------------------------------- /rabbitmq/cert-enroller.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/rabbitmq/cert-enroller.sh -------------------------------------------------------------------------------- /rabbitmq/cert-post-enroll-hook.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/rabbitmq/cert-post-enroll-hook.sh -------------------------------------------------------------------------------- /rabbitmq/cert-post-renew-hook.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/rabbitmq/cert-post-renew-hook.sh -------------------------------------------------------------------------------- /rabbitmq/cert-renewer.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/rabbitmq/cert-renewer.sh -------------------------------------------------------------------------------- /rabbitmq/entrypoint-shim.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/rabbitmq/entrypoint-shim.sh -------------------------------------------------------------------------------- /rabbitmq/rabbitmq-tls.conf: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/rabbitmq/rabbitmq-tls.conf -------------------------------------------------------------------------------- /redis-ionotify-certwatch/Dockerfile: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/redis-ionotify-certwatch/Dockerfile -------------------------------------------------------------------------------- /redis-ionotify-certwatch/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/redis-ionotify-certwatch/README.md -------------------------------------------------------------------------------- /redis-ionotify-certwatch/certwatch.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/redis-ionotify-certwatch/certwatch.sh -------------------------------------------------------------------------------- /redis-ionotify-certwatch/docker-entrypoint.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/redis-ionotify-certwatch/docker-entrypoint.sh -------------------------------------------------------------------------------- /redis/Dockerfile: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/redis/Dockerfile -------------------------------------------------------------------------------- /redis/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/redis/README.md -------------------------------------------------------------------------------- /redis/cert-enroller.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/redis/cert-enroller.sh -------------------------------------------------------------------------------- /redis/cert-post-enroll-hook.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/redis/cert-post-enroll-hook.sh -------------------------------------------------------------------------------- /redis/cert-post-renew-hook.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/redis/cert-post-renew-hook.sh -------------------------------------------------------------------------------- /redis/cert-renewer.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/redis/cert-renewer.sh -------------------------------------------------------------------------------- /redis/entrypoint-shim.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/redis/entrypoint-shim.sh -------------------------------------------------------------------------------- /timescaledb/Dockerfile: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/timescaledb/Dockerfile -------------------------------------------------------------------------------- /timescaledb/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/timescaledb/README.md -------------------------------------------------------------------------------- /timescaledb/cert-enroller.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/timescaledb/cert-enroller.sh -------------------------------------------------------------------------------- /timescaledb/cert-post-enroll-hook.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/timescaledb/cert-post-enroll-hook.sh -------------------------------------------------------------------------------- /timescaledb/cert-post-renew-hook.sh: -------------------------------------------------------------------------------- 1 | #!/bin/bash 2 | 3 | su-exec postgres pg_ctl reload 4 | -------------------------------------------------------------------------------- /timescaledb/cert-renewer.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/timescaledb/cert-renewer.sh -------------------------------------------------------------------------------- /timescaledb/entrypoint-shim.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/smallstep/docker-tls/HEAD/timescaledb/entrypoint-shim.sh --------------------------------------------------------------------------------